An atom is made up three fundamental particles:
- Protons are the positively charged particles in an atom
- Electrons are the negatively charged particles
- Neutrons carry no charges.
The mass number is the sum of protons and neutrons in an atom because they contribute to the mass of an atom.
The atomic number is the number of protons in an atom. For a neutral atom, it is the same as the number of electrons.
Number of neutrons = mass number - atomic number
For seaborgium,
Number of neutrons = 266 - 106 = 160
